Access数据库参数查询的定义与应用解析
在Access数据库应用中,参数查询是一种查询方式,它允许用户在查询时输入参数值,以便根据用户提供的条件从数据库中检索特定的数据。参数查询可以提高查询的灵活性和实用性,使用户能够根据不同的需求来获取所需的数据。
以下是关于参数查询的几个要点:
-
参数查询的语法:在Access中,参数查询可以使用参数表达式或参数提示来定义查询的参数。参数表达式可以是任何有效的表达式,例如字段名、常量、函数等。参数提示是一种让用户输入参数值的方法,可以在查询运行时显示提示对话框,用户可以在对话框中输入参数值。
-
参数查询的优势:参数查询可以根据用户的输入动态地生成查询结果,使查询更加灵活和实用。用户可以根据不同的条件来过滤数据,从而获取所需的结果。参数查询还可以减少查询的复杂性,提高查询的效率。
-
参数查询的应用场景:参数查询适用于各种不同的应用场景,例如根据日期范围查询销售记录、根据关键字查询文档、根据部门查询员工等。参数查询可以根据具体的需求来设计,满足不同查询条件的要求。
-
参数查询的使用方法:在Access中,可以使用查询设计视图或SQL语句来创建参数查询。在查询设计视图中,用户可以选择字段、添加条件和参数,然后运行查询以获取结果。在SQL语句中,可以使用参数表达式或参数提示来定义参数,然后使用参数值来过滤数据。
-
参数查询的注意事项:在使用参数查询时,需要注意以下几点。确保参数的数据类型和查询字段的数据类型匹配,否则可能会导致查询失败或返回错误的结果。参数查询可能会影响查询的性能,特别是在处理大量数据时,需要合理设计查询条件和索引以提高查询效率。最后,对于需要频繁使用的参数查询,可以考虑创建参数查询的查询对象,以便在不同的查询中重复使用。
参数查询是一种在 Access 数据库应用中使用的一种查询方法,它允许用户在运行查询时输入参数值,以便根据特定的条件筛选查询结果。通过参数查询,用户可以根据自己的需要灵活地过滤和检索数据库中的数据。
参数查询的作用是使用户能够根据不同的条件来查询数据,而不需要每次都修改查询语句。通过使用参数查询,用户可以根据需要输入不同的参数值,以便查询特定的数据。这样可以大大提高查询的灵活性和效率。
在 Access 中,参数查询可以通过查询设计视图或 SQL 语句的方式实现。在查询设计视图中,用户可以通过在查询条件中使用参数标记(如 [请输入参数值])来定义参数查询。用户可以在运行查询时输入具体的参数值,以便查询特定的数据。
在 SQL 语句中,参数查询可以使用参数表达式(如 [请输入参数值])或参数查询条件(如 [请输入参数值])来定义。用户可以在运行查询时输入具体的参数值,以便查询特定的数据。
使用参数查询的好处是可以减少用户在查询时的工作量,并提高查询的灵活性。用户只需要输入相关的参数值,而不需要每次都修改查询语句。同时,参数查询还可以提高查询的效率,因为 Access 可以根据参数值优化查询的执行计划,从而更快地返回查询结果。
参数查询是一种在 Access 数据库应用中常用的查询方法,它允许用户根据特定的条件输入参数值,以便灵活地过滤和检索数据库中的数据。使用参数查询可以减少用户的工作量,提高查询的灵活性和效率。
参数查询是在Access数据库应用中使用查询来过滤数据时,可以通过用户输入参数来定义查询条件的一种方式。它允许用户在运行查询之前输入特定的值,以便查询可以根据这些值来过滤和返回符合条件的数据。
参数查询可以用于各种情况,例如根据特定日期范围、特定产品名称或特定地区来过滤数据。通过参数查询,用户可以在运行查询时灵活地输入不同的值,以便查询结果可以根据输入的参数进行动态调整。
在Access中,可以通过以下步骤创建参数查询:
- 打开Access数据库应用程序,并选择“查询”选项卡。
- 在“查询设计”视图中,选择“新建查询”。
- 在“显示表”窗格中选择要查询的表或查询,并将其添加到查询设计窗格中。
- 在查询设计窗格中,选择“参数”选项卡。
- 在“参数”选项卡中,点击“添加参数”按钮。
- 在“参数名称”栏中输入参数的名称,例如“StartDate”。
- 在“数据类型”栏中选择参数的数据类型,例如“日期/时间”。
- 在“提示”栏中输入用户输入参数时显示的提示信息,例如“请输入开始日期”。
- 在“默认值”栏中输入参数的默认值,例如“[今天]”表示默认值为当前日期。
- 在查询设计窗格中,根据需要在查询条件中使用参数。例如,可以在“条件”行中输入类似于“[开始日期] <= [订单日期]”的条件。
- 点击“运行”按钮来运行查询。在运行查询时,Access会提示用户输入参数的值。
- 输入参数的值并点击“确定”按钮,查询将根据输入的参数值来过滤和返回数据。
通过参数查询,用户可以动态地输入不同的参数值来过滤数据,使查询更加灵活和适应不同的需求。它可以提高查询的可用性和用户体验,并使用户能够更方便地获取所需的数据。